Web30 sep. 2024 · Bull calves fed diets to achieve 1.4 - 1.5 kg/day average daily gain reach puberty earlier with greater paired testes weight and daily sperm output. 2,29,30 In general, with an average daily gain of 1 kg/day, puberty occurs at 8 - 12 months. 31 Preweaning early development of bulls was largely dependent on maternal milk production. WebFigure 1 presents a diagram of the complete reproductive tract anatomy. Figure 1. Diagram of the reproductive tract of the cow. (Adapted from Rich and Turman, n.d.) The ovary produces the egg by a process called oogenesis. In contrast to the continuous production of sperm (spermatogenesis) in the male, oogenesis is cyclic. Bulls are much more muscular than cows, with thicker bones, larger feet, a very muscular neck, and a large, bony head with protective ridges over the eyes. These features assist bulls in fighting for domination over a herd, giving the winner superior access to cows for reproduction.
